With a stay at St.Giles Wembley Penang, you'll be centrally located in George Town, steps from KOMTAR and a short 3-minute drive from Gurney Drive. This hotel is 2.7 mi (4.3 km) from Gurney Plaza and 4.4 mi (7 km) from Penang Hill. Don't miss out on recreational opportunities including an outdoor pool and a fitness center. Additional features at this hotel include complimentary wireless internet access, concierge services, and gift shops/newsstands. Satisfy your appetite for lunch or dinner at the hotel's restaurant, Wembley Cafe, or stay in and take advantage of the room service (during limited hours). Relax with a refreshing drink at one of the 2 bars/lounges. Buffet breakfasts are available daily from 7:00 AM to 10:30 AM for a fee. Featured amenities include complimentary wired internet access, a business center, and dry cleaning/laundry services. Planning an event in George Town? This hotel has 32292 square feet (3000 square meters) of space consisting of conference space and 10 meeting rooms. Free self parking is available onsite. Make yourself at home in one of the 415 air-conditioned rooms featuring LCD televisions. Your bed comes with down comforters and premium bedding.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and satellite programming is available for your entertainment. Private bathrooms have complimentary toiletries and bidets.

Getting to Shangri-La Rasa Sayang from the airport takes about 50 minutes by Grab (around 70+ MYR, 100+ MYR at night). From George Town, it's about a 20-minute Grab ride (around 20+ MYR). The hotel offers two free shuttle buses daily to and from George Town (see picture 5; just book at the concierge desk). Alternatively, public bus 101 stops right outside the hotel and goes to George Town (2.7 MYR per person, cash only). The hotel is huge, connected to the Golden Sands next door. You can explore both on foot or by using the hotel's complimentary buggy service. The breakfast selection is decent, but nothing particularly stood out to me. Room cleanliness, water pressure, and air conditioning were generally satisfactory. The toiletries are Shangri-La's own brand, with that distinctive Southeast Asian scent, and the bedding was very comfortable. The hotel is very close to Batu Ferringhi Beach, within walking distance. It's a great spot to watch the sunset, grab dinner, and then enjoy a fire show after dark – very chill. Across from the hotel, there's a durian shop offering an 88 MYR all-you-can-eat buffet. However, I'd recommend buying individual 'Black Thorn,' 'Red Prawn,' and 'Musang King' durians instead; these Penang specialties are delicious and better value. You can pay with cash (MYR) or Alipay (at an exchange rate of 1.7 to RMB). A special shout-out to the concierge service! We had an early morning flight home and wanted to explore George Town after checking out, but dragging luggage around would have been inconvenient. The concierge proactively arranged for us to store our luggage for free at their sister hotel, Shangri-La's Hotel JEN George Town. Even better, after our sightseeing, we were allowed to use Hotel JEN's gym and showers free of charge (Penang is hot and humid, so you get sweaty quickly outdoors). This meant we could freshen up before heading to the airport. From Hotel JEN, a Grab to the airport costs about 30+ MYR, or you can take public buses 102/401/401E directly from behind the hotel for just 2.7 MYR per person.
